Subject: [PATCH 6/6] staging: brcm80211: remove retrieval function for tsf in wlc_main.c
Date: Mon, 18 Apr 2011 15:31:51 +0200 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<1303133511-8300-6-git-send-email-arend@broadcom.com>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<1303133511-8300-1-git-send-email-arend@broadcom.com>
wlc_main.c provides a function to read the tsf, but it is not used.
Consequently, it is removed.
Reviewed-by: Roland Vossen <rvossen@broadcom.com>
Reviewed-by: Henry Ptasinski <henryp@broadcom.com>
Signed-off-by: Arend van Spriel <arend@broadcom.com>
Cc: devel@linuxdriverproject.org
Cc: linux-wireless@vger.kernel.org
---
drivers/staging/brcm80211/brcmsmac/wlc_main.c | 5 -----
drivers/staging/brcm80211/brcmsmac/wlc_main.h | 2 --
2 files changed, 0 insertions(+), 7 deletions(-)
diff --git a/drivers/staging/brcm80211/brcmsmac/wlc_main.c b/drivers/staging/brcm80211/brcmsmac/wlc_main.c
index 34584be..6fb9d9c 100644
--- a/drivers/staging/brcm80211/brcmsmac/wlc_main.c
+++ b/drivers/staging/brcm80211/brcmsmac/wlc_main.c
@@ -7861,11 +7861,6 @@ void wlc_set_rcmta(struct wlc_info *wlc, int idx, const u8 *addr)
wlc_bmac_set_rcmta(wlc->hw, idx, addr);
}
-void wlc_read_tsf(struct wlc_info *wlc, u32 *tsf_l_ptr, u32 *tsf_h_ptr)
-{
- wlc_bmac_read_tsf(wlc->hw, tsf_l_ptr, tsf_h_ptr);
-}
-
void wlc_set_cwmin(struct wlc_info *wlc, u16 newmin)
{
wlc->band->CWmin = newmin;
diff --git a/drivers/staging/brcm80211/brcmsmac/wlc_main.h b/drivers/staging/brcm80211/brcmsmac/wlc_main.h
index d1114e8..34023fa 100644
--- a/drivers/staging/brcm80211/brcmsmac/wlc_main.h
+++ b/drivers/staging/brcm80211/brcmsmac/wlc_main.h
@@ -813,8 +813,6 @@ extern void wlc_get_rcmta(struct wlc_info *wlc, int idx,
#endif
extern void wlc_set_rcmta(struct wlc_info *wlc, int idx,
const u8 *addr);
-extern void wlc_read_tsf(struct wlc_info *wlc, u32 *tsf_l_ptr,
- u32 *tsf_h_ptr);
extern void wlc_set_cwmin(struct wlc_info *wlc, u16 newmin);
extern void wlc_set_cwmax(struct wlc_info *wlc, u16 newmax);
extern void wlc_fifoerrors(struct wlc_info *wlc);
